The weather can make or break your vacation, so consider the type of conditions you prefer to travel in. Tbilisi is warmest in July, averaging between 63ºF and 93ºF.
Temperatures are at their lowest in January, when they range from 27ºF to 46ºF.
With two days of rain on average, August is the driest month in Tbilisi.
The wettest time of year is May. Plan your getaway then and you'll likely get around nine days of rainfall.

Getting to central Tbilisi from Tbilisi International Airport (TBS)
Central Tbilisi is about 11 miles from TBS.
If you're planning to catch a cab after your flight to TBS, it'll take around 25 minutes to get to the center.
Expect the ride to take about 1 hour when using public transport.
